I'm trying to build R3.13.1 and have hit the
following problem. In the antelope build section, I
get the following error message:
>
make[4]: Entering directory
`/tmp_mnt/radonc/cnts/epics/base/src/toolsComm/antelope/O.hp700'
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../closure.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../error.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../lalr.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../lr0.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../main.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../mkpar.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../output.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../reader.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../skeleton.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../symtab.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../verbose.c
gcc -ansi -pedantic -O -w -D_NO_PROTO -D_HPUX_SOURCE -DHP_UX -DUNIX
-I. -I.. -I../../../../include -I../../../../include/os/hp700 -c
../warshall.c
make[5]: Entering directory
`/tmp_mnt/radonc/cnts/epics/base/src/toolsComm/antelope/O.hp700'
../../../../config/RULES.Host:405: *** unterminated variable reference.
Stop.
<
This points me towards the following line in RULES.Host:
>
$(PRODNAME): $(PRODNAME_OBJS) $(PRODNAME_RESS)
@$(RM) $@
$(PRODNAME_LINKER) $(PRODNAME_OBJS) $(PRODNAME_RESS) $(LDLIBS)
<
with the "@$(RM) $@" being line 405.
Has anyone seen this problem before? Have any ideas on what
I may have done wrong? I'm trying to install on a HPUX machine.
